# Env file — Cartwheel dispatch, driver-assignment heuristic
# Scope: staging only. Do not promote to prod.
# The heuristic weights (proximity, shift balance, refusal rate) are tuned
# for the Velmont pilot region and will misbehave elsewhere.
# Review notes: heuristic service runs unprivileged; it reads weights
# read-only from the tuning store and writes nothing back.
# Only one sensitive value exists in this file: the tuning-store access
# credential, consumed at boot and never logged.
# That credential is set on the following line.

secret setting of faduf-bahop: LEDGER_TOKEN8=c3b363be

Search relevance tuning, Brontel plugin authors. Boosts are multiplicative; cap at 4x. Field weights: title 3, body 1, tags 2. Synonym maps load at index build, not query time. Test against the Marlowe corpus before submitting. Decay functions apply only to dated content. Do not override the tiebreaker scorer. Plugin sandbox accounts lock after three failed ranking-profile pushes. If locked, use the break-glass console at Vexhall ops. Authenticate with the recovery passphrase that follows.

unlock words, yawig-kagef: gordor-holvan-ulaael-pramir-ulaiel-tamdor

## Service Accounts — StormFan Alert Fan-Out

The fan-out worker authenticates to the internal dispatch tier using the svc-stormfan account. Rotate quarterly; scopes are limited to publish-only on alert topics. If deliveries stall during your shift, verify the worker is using the current credential, reproduced below for reference.

API key for kaweg-hahif: kto4_rAjZ

## Authentication

Plugins for Cartwright, the shipping-fee rules engine, authenticate per request. Send your plugin token in the X-Cartwright-Token header; unsigned requests are rejected with 403. Tokens are scoped: rule evaluation only, no tariff writes. Rate limit is 50 req/s per plugin. Request a production token through the partner portal. For the shared sandbox environment, all plugin authors use the common sandbox key below.

gateway credential: vxb4-QTMv

## Artifact Signing — Dedupler

Dedupler collapses duplicate on-call alerts before they page anyone. Every Dedupler build must be signed or the alert routers at Norbeck refuse to load it. Support: if a build shows `UNSIGNED` in the rollout panel, escalate — do not force-load. To verify a build manually, check its signature against the key below.

rollout seal: bky4_x7Gc